How Edge Computing is Reshaping Smart City Infrastructure

The integration of artificial intelligence with edge computing represents a significant leap forward for urban security systems.

Unlike traditional cloud-dependent setups that require constant connectivity and may experience latency issues, edge-based systems process information locally. Consequently, this approach drastically reduces response times while improving reliability in critical situations.

MatrixSpace’s collaboration with Dell Technologies exemplifies how AI-powered edge Solutions can address real-world challenges effectively.

By leveraging Dell NativeEdge, MatrixSpace has substantially improved the performance of its 360 Radar technology, creating a more robust framework for situational awareness applications.

Real-World Applications: Palm Springs Police Department

The practical value of these advanced AI-powered edge Solutions becomes evident through their implementation in Palm Springs, California.

The City of Palm Springs Police Department (PSPD) has become an early adopter of this integrated solution, deploying a network of MatrixSpace 360 Radars powered by Dell NativeEdge.

This technology supports their innovative “Drone as First Responder” (DFR) program, which represents a significant advancement in emergency response methodology. The system enables:

  • Immediate dispatch of remotely piloted drones to emergency scenes
  • De-escalation of potentially dangerous incidents
  • Efficient location of suspects in developing situations
  • Enhanced search and rescue capabilities
  • Vital force multiplication for limited police resources

Security and Resilience Considerations

An often overlooked advantage of edge-based systems is their inherent resilience. Because processing occurs locally, these systems can continue functioning even if wider network connectivity is compromised.

This characteristic makes them particularly valuable for critical infrastructure protection and emergency response scenarios.

The security enhancements provided by Dell NativeEdge also address growing concerns about data protection in interconnected systems.

By managing and securing technology deployed in the field, this software solution helps maintain the integrity of sensitive information while still enabling the rapid response capabilities that make edge computing valuable.
